Meeker scores career-high 27 in loss to MWC unbeaten Beloit

MOUNT VERNON – Jayden Meeker poured in a career-best 27 points, although the Rams couldn't knock off Beloit from the ranks of Midwest Conference unbeatens in Saturday's 70-60 men's basketball loss inside the Small Athletic and Wellness Center.
 
Meeker helped keep the Rams (2-8 overall, 0-4 MWC) within striking distance, netting 14 points after intermission. The 6-foot-4 junior guard finished 13-of-22 shooting from the field and also collected five rebounds, four assists and three steals in a superb performance.
 
Beloit (7-2 overall, 4-0 MWC) made its hay from the foul line, hitting 22-of-36 attempts. The Rams made 4-of-10 free throws, including 1-of-6 in the second half.
 
The Buccaneers won the battle on the boards, 46-29, and snapped a five-game series losing streak against the Rams.
 
Cornell trailed 31-30 at halftime and pulled within 56-52 on a Dylan Hurley putback with less than five minutes to go. Beloit scored on its next three possessions to build the lead back to 63-52 and held on from there.
 
Junior Jaxson Herring had a solid game for the Rams with eight points, eight rebounds and three steals. Zach Ingle hit three 3-pointers and finished with 10 points. Hurley added five rebounds.
 
Beloit was paced by Azeez Ganiyu's double-double of 16 points and 14 rebounds.
 
Coming up – The Rams travel to play rival Coe (8-1) at 7:30 p.m. Wednesday in Cedar Rapids. The Kohawks won the first meeting this season, 78-64.
